   ### Version
   
   4.0.7-rc02-35854e7e92a
   
   ### What's Wrong?
   
   grep -A 15 "1784283889" be.out
   *** Aborted at 1784283889 (unix time) try "date -d @1784283889" if you are 
using GNU date ***
   *** Current BE git commitID: 35854e7e92a ***
   *** SIGSEGV address not mapped to object (@0x1f8) received by PID 2929477 
(TID 3000255 OR 0x7d4622d7b6c0) from PID 504; stack trace: ***
    0# doris::signal::(anonymous namespace)::FailureSignalHandler(int, 
siginfo_t*, void*) at 
/home/zcp/repo_center/doris_release/doris/be/src/common/signal_handler.h:420
    1# PosixSignals::chained_handler(int, siginfo_t*, void*) in 
/usr/lib/jvm/java-17-openjdk-amd64/lib/server/libjvm.so
    2# JVM_handle_linux_signal in 
/usr/lib/jvm/java-17-openjdk-amd64/lib/server/libjvm.so
    3# 0x00007D6150845330 in /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libc.so.6
    4# doris::RuntimeState::is_nereids() const at 
/home/zcp/repo_center/doris_release/doris/be/src/runtime/runtime_state.cpp:511
    5# doris::AttachTask::AttachTask(doris::RuntimeState*) at 
/home/zcp/repo_center/doris_release/doris/be/src/runtime/thread_context.cpp:47
    6# std::_Function_handler<void (), 
doris::vectorized::AsyncResultWriter::start_writer(doris::RuntimeState*, 
doris::RuntimeProfile*)::$_0>::_M_invoke(std::_Any_data const&) at 
/usr/local/ldb-toolchain-v0.26/bin/../lib/gcc/x86_64-pc-linux-gnu/15/include/g++-v15/bits/std_function.h:292
    7# doris::ThreadPool::dispatch_thread() at 
/home/zcp/repo_center/doris_release/doris/be/src/util/threadpool.cpp:623
    8# doris::Thread::supervise_thread(void*) at 
/home/zcp/repo_center/doris_release/doris/be/src/util/thread.cpp:461
    9# 0x00007D615089CAA4 in /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libc.so.6
   10# 0x00007D6150929C6C in /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libc.so.6
   
   INFO: java_cmd /usr/lib/jvm/java-17-openjdk-amd64/bin/java
   
   ### What You Expected?
   
   No BE crash
   
   ### How to Reproduce?
   
   Not yet isolated into a minimal repro. Observed in production: BE crashed 
with the above 
   trace while running queries against a JDBC External Catalog (MS SQL Server). 
The crash 
   occurs inside the async result-writer's thread pool dispatch, when 
constructing an 
   AttachTask from a RuntimeState pointer — consistent with the RuntimeState 
having already 
   been destroyed by that point (use-after-free)
